This recipe was extracted from Jane Hamilton's recipes (1909) by Charlotte Mason Poindexter, page 25. The excerpt below is the record exactly as published.
WAFFLES, RICE. Boil half a pound of rice, when it is cold add to it four eggs, a pint of flour, and a little salt, mixing up the whole with as much sweet milk as will make it a soft batter
